Emergency Medical Technician (EMT) PRN
Indiana Packers Corporation (IPC) is seeking an Emergency Medical Technician (EMT) to respond to emergencies and provide treatment to employees who have been injured or become ill due to work-related or personal causes. This position will work with worker's compensation claims and investigations and collaborate closely with other departments to ensure adherence to medical and safety protocols.
About the role
This is a PRN position requiring availability to pick up at least 4 days a month, including at least 1 Saturday a month. The role does not have set hours and will cover shifts for staff on vacation, PTO, or sick days.
